Apply for a special permit to enter the Weserstadion residents' zone
If you are a resident, trader, freelancer, institution or association in the Weserstadion residents' zone, you can apply for a special permit to enter the Weserstadion residents' zone during a major event.
-
Basic information
The residents' zone is intended to prevent parking search traffic and parking by stadium visitors in the area close to the Weser Stadium and thus relieve residents of this traffic.
Access to the zone is controlled by the police and a private security service.
Where and when is it closed?
The area between Stader Straße and Lüneburger Straße as well as Am Schwarzen Meer/Am Hulsberg and Osterdeich is closed to cars.
Motorcycles are exempt from the closure.
The closure of the residents' zone begins 2.5 hours before a major event at the Weserstadion and ends shortly after the start of the event.
The Osterdeich remains closed between Lübecker Straße and Stader Straße until shortly after the end of the event.
This regulation applies to major events at the Weserstadion.
Only residents and local businesses, freelancers, institutions and clubs in the Weserstadion residents' zone may enter the residents' zone with an exemption permit.
You can apply for such a special permit from the Bremen Department of Roads and Traffic.
Requirements
All residents, tradespeople, freelancers, institutions or clubs in the Weserstadion resident zone who can prove their place of residence/registered office and who own a vehicle or have one provided for their use are eligible.

More information
Data from the documents that is not required for identification purposes can be blacked out on the copy. Copies submitted will be destroyed for data protection reasons once the exemption has been granted.
Care or delivery services are generally permitted to pass through the checkpoints on presentation of the delivery bill or by stating the address of use.
Visitor cards will not be issued in order to avoid misuse. Please be prepared for the situation and inform your guests/visitors.

Deadlines & processing time
What deadlines must be paid attention to?
The exemption permit is valid until the end of the season on 31.07.
How long does it take to process
Please note that the processing time for special permits is 2 to 3 weeks.
If a new season begins (e.g. season from 01.08.2027 to 31.07.2030), the processing time is around 3 months due to the high volume of applications.
The exemption permits will be sent by post by the deadline of 31.07.2027 if the online applications are submitted in full by 30.06.2027.
